PPT Text 1:10.
Paul asks 2 questions and comes with a sobering chilling conclusion.
I am seeking the approval of man or God? (In my life, the way I live my life who am I trying to live for other translations – persuade). 1.
Or am I trying to pleas man? (People pleasing). 2.
If I was still trying to pleas man, I would not be a servant of Christ. (BOOM)
(A rejection of the only true gospel can lead to pleasing men, enslavement to others)
As one wrote this is rhetorical question’s, Paul is not trying to pleas men, as we read in verse 9. And not only is he not trying to pleas men, like Jesus Paul will say it is not even possible, to pleas men, and be a servant of Christ. (That means pleasing men is a false gospel that leads us away form Jesus).
(Note on servant – a willing slave of Christ).
